Extremely precise, energy-saving and nearly noiseless

Excellent controllability, extremely small control fluctuations, low-vibration operation and impressive energy savings provide the added value from the application-oriented adaption of the Peltier technology in the Memmert cooled incubator series IPP. Due to the finely adjusted control technology, temperatures reach the set point precisely, thus no temperature overshoots can be a hazard for the chamber load. The working chamber is completely sealed off from the environment, providing a crucial advantage: condensation formation during the cooling down process takes place outside the working chamber, therefore there is a minimal risk of the sample drying out.
